Handover — Vexler partner SFTP drop

Ownership moves to you today. Drop runs hourly from Vexler's end into the intake bucket via the relay host. Watch for zero-byte files; their exporter flakes on Mondays. Creds live in the ops vault, path noted in the runbook. Vault auto-seals after 48h idle. Support escalations go to the on-call rotation, not me. If the vault is sealed when you need it, unseal with the recovery passphrase below.

recovery phrase for tadug-fafof: zorwyn-kasion

## DeployBot Quickstart

DeployBot posts deploy status to the #releases channel. Ask it things like "status of Lanternfish" or "last deploy prod". It answers in-thread.

Commands: `status`, `history`, `rollback-info`. No write actions — it's read-only by design.

If it stops responding, check the Harborline status page first. Still broken? Contact the platform on-call team at the address below.

escalation mailbox, yajeg-bageg: quenax.olidor@lumiccorp.internal

// Broker upgrade notes for plugin authors:
// Quillbus 4.x replaces the legacy 3.x wire protocol. Plugins must
// construct the client with explicit protocol negotiation enabled,
// or connections to the Larkfield cluster will be silently downgraded
// and dropped after 30s. Topic names are unchanged. For local testing
// against the sandbox broker, authenticate with the key below.

API key for bafof-bagaf: qvz2-qi